A beautiful way to display products from affiliate network product feeds on your website. Currently supports Daisycon, TradeTracker and AdTraction.
With the Affiliate Product Highlights plugin for WordPress you can create beautiful in-content sections showing relevant products from product feeds of various affiliate networks.
Networks currently supported:
- AdTraction
- TradeTracker
- Daisycon
Features:
- Automatic product feed import: Product feeds are updated daily for up-to-date pricing and product availability
- Cloaked links: Affiliate links are redirected through your own website URL
- Fast & efficient: Product data is stored locally, product images are sideloaded and optimized
- Flexible shortcode: Show random products, specific products, search by (partial) product name

- Download the latest version
- Upload the plugin through 'Plugins' > 'Add New' > 'Upload plugin' in your WordPress Dashboard
- Add one or more affiliate product feeds through 'Affiliate Product Highlights' > 'Feeds'
- Place the [product-highlights] shortcode wherever you want to display your affiliate products using attributes below
selection: An ID of a selection of products generated through 'Affiliate Product Highlights' > 'Selections'limit: The amount of products that should be displayed (default: 6)product_ids: Display specific product IDs. Separated by a comma, e.g. 123,323,312 (currently no easy way to get these IDs apart from going into PHPMyAdmin)search: Show only products containing this word or sentence in their title (may be inefficient with a lot of products in the database)random: Randomize the results
[product-highlights selection=107]: Show products from the selection with ID 107[product-highlights selection=107 limit=1 random=1]: Show a single random product from the selection with ID 107[product-highlights product_ids="2304,2306,2307,665"]: Show products with specific IDs
The plugin comes with minimal styling that can be easily adjusted with some custom CSS.
phft-products-multiple(div): Wrapper class around all products (if thelimitparameter is higher than 1)phft-product(div): Product wrapper classphft-product-image(div): Product image wrapper (contains a > img)phft-product-description(div)phft-product-price(div)phft-button-link(a): The call-to-action button
Colors can be adjusted by overriding the default CSS variables:
--phft-button-text-color: Button text color (default: #fff)--phft-button-background-color: Button background color (default: #611431)--phft-button-hover-color: Button hover color (default: #363636)--phft-product-border-color: Color for the border around the individual products
